I used the Eden's Garden stamp set and coordinating Eden dies (which I am happy to have earned for FREE during Sale-a-Bration last month!) for today's card along with the Petal Park builder punch to create the flower embellishment. My color palette includes Basic White, Garden Green, Old Olive and Pear Pizzazz.
Here is a close-up of the flower and part of the die-cut border. Isn't it pretty? To find out how I created the flower, be sure to check out this blog post from January 15th where I shared the instructions. I also sponged the outside edges of the flower petals to give it a little more pop. I added a rhinestone jewel in the center of the flower and added a few smaller ones on the card as well.
For the inside of the card, I left it super simple and just stamped one of the foliage images from the set with Pear Pizzazz ink.
